The Future of Onboarding: Trends in HRIS

EmployeeConnect

The onboarding process is a critical stage in an employee’s journey within an organisation. A well-structured onboarding program can lead to increased employee engagement, faster productivity, and higher retention rates. As technology continues to evolve, so do the tools and systems used to facilitate onboarding.

Reducing Turnover with Data-Driven HR Software Solutions

EmployeeConnect

As companies strive to retain top talent, leveraging data-driven HR software solutions has emerged as a powerful strategy for understanding and addressing the root causes of employee turnover. By examining this data, organizations can identify trends and patterns that may indicate underlying issues within the workforce.
